Myrtle (Myrtus communis) is an aromatic, evergreen shrub or small tree native to the Mediterranean region. However, in woodworking, the term “Myrtle” often refers to the wood of the Pacific Myrtle tree (Umbellularia californica), which is found in the western United States, particularly in California and Oregon. This wood is highly prized for its rich colour, fine texture, and exceptional workability.
Myrtle wood features a beautiful range of hues, from pale yellows to rich golden browns, with occasional reddish tinges or dark streaks. The wood’s grain is typically straight but can sometimes be wavy or curly, offering a unique aesthetic appeal. Myrtle is a moderately dense hardwood with good strength and durability, making it well-suited for a variety of woodworking applications. It is often used in the creation of fine furniture, cabinetry, musical instruments, and decorative items due to its excellent finishing properties and the ability to take on a polished, lustrous appearance.
